Commit Graph

  • 0949f5b342 libmthread: don't free() user allocated stack space Thomas Veerman 2012-02-10 09:16:00 +00:00
  • de89517711 libblockdriver: increase stack size to 8KB per thread David van Moolenbroek 2012-02-09 22:28:18 +01:00
  • 35abd4867a silence makewhatis in daily script Ben Gras 2012-02-10 17:24:54 +01:00
  • f87b9a3d2d sys: move some include dirs Antoine Leca 2012-02-10 17:02:47 +01:00
  • 02b46221dd .gitignore: add another generated directory Antoine Leca 2012-02-10 17:01:42 +01:00
  • 0c99f4f4b7 AVFS: reinitialize lookup object before reuse Thomas Veerman 2012-02-10 09:35:19 +00:00
  • e93c1c9f28 Also clean share/*, including zoneinfo Antoine Leca 2012-02-10 00:46:55 +01:00
  • 3ab668c366 Fix shutdown message in setup.sh Evgeniy Ivanov 2012-02-07 22:55:18 +04:00
  • 1ae162d673 Proper banner for CD. Evgeniy Ivanov 2012-02-07 22:54:08 +04:00
  • 61a29c4291 Warn users about non NetBSD mbr. Evgeniy Ivanov 2012-02-07 22:52:36 +04:00
  • 6f88dc8713 Support reinstall and new boot. Evgeniy Ivanov 2012-02-07 19:14:27 +04:00
  • d4ddfeb2c0 Build both old boot and new boot (for setup). Evgeniy Ivanov 2012-02-06 17:56:49 +04:00
  • 5a46076652 Build release CD based on new boot. Evgeniy Ivanov 2012-02-02 15:02:34 +04:00
  • 3f2ab5b34b writeisofs: also boots plain binaries with -B Antoine Leca 2012-01-17 16:08:40 +01:00
  • 2ae897db7b writeisofs: improve compatibility Antoine Leca 2012-02-03 11:24:48 +01:00
  • 13d8a6969a Add new boot to the setup. Evgeniy Ivanov 2012-01-30 17:21:41 +04:00
  • 68bd32bedb Build ELF for release (chrootmake). Evgeniy Ivanov 2012-01-30 17:40:16 +04:00
  • 7a60d6d33f Switch part/autopart to new mbr bootblock Antoine Leca 2012-01-12 18:14:44 +01:00
  • 636264c1c6 Fixes for loading kernel with multiboot Ben Gras 2012-02-09 18:49:24 +01:00
  • 3dd49be938 Allow human readable name for the root device. Evgeniy Ivanov 2012-01-31 15:48:14 +04:00
  • 8979450631 Rotate kernels/images/modules. Evgeniy Ivanov 2012-01-30 16:27:23 +04:00
  • 60a2ce010a Integrate new boot stuff into build scheme. Evgeniy Ivanov 2012-01-25 23:32:10 +04:00
  • 7f2d47d84c Remove libkern, leave just header. Evgeniy Ivanov 2012-01-25 16:29:07 +04:00
  • 002fecdd9e Port cdboot. Evgeniy Ivanov 2012-01-14 22:43:40 +04:00
  • 174e3c15af Import cdboot. Evgeniy Ivanov 2012-01-14 22:33:29 +04:00
  • 81d26afebe Port MBR. Evgeniy Ivanov 2012-01-10 20:43:33 +04:00
  • 6acebc04b6 Import sys/arch/i386/stand/mbr. Evgeniy Ivanov 2012-01-10 14:01:31 +04:00
  • fa6c4a2580 Port installboot as installboot_nbsd and rename the old one. Evgeniy Ivanov 2012-01-10 13:45:46 +04:00
  • 9f8e6353e5 Import usr.sbin/installboot. Evgeniy Ivanov 2012-01-10 12:46:52 +04:00
  • 4c4c045f87 Port bootxx. Evgeniy Ivanov 2012-01-09 18:11:34 +04:00
  • 602233213e Adjust boot from NetBSD. Evgeniy Ivanov 2012-02-04 14:21:30 +04:00
  • f119e63750 Fix bug in libsa/ls. Evgeniy Ivanov 2012-02-04 21:26:58 +04:00
  • 58a2b0008e Initial import of libsa, libkern, bootxx, boot. Evgeniy Ivanov 2012-01-09 18:07:58 +04:00
  • 972a791882 AVFS/APFS: small cleanup Thomas Veerman 2012-02-09 16:33:24 +00:00
  • abd6043a2f AVFS: fix various system call interruption issues Thomas Veerman 2012-02-09 14:24:28 +00:00
  • 4498750810 libchardriver: fix open reply for async devices Thomas Veerman 2012-02-09 10:32:08 +00:00
  • cc1ae59c9b -lminixutil link fixes Ben Gras 2012-02-03 14:03:59 +01:00
  • 65f97ea344 Enlarge ramdisk size (blocks). Evgeniy Ivanov 2011-12-23 14:56:15 +04:00
  • 14fc51e8aa NBSD INCLUDES - fixed missing vm_remap_ro() proto Tomas Hruby 2012-02-02 23:55:38 +00:00
  • 1eea0f5680 inet: strncmp() fix Ben Gras 2012-02-03 14:49:18 +01:00
  • cdbc4bfb13 temporarily disable update-superblock check Ben Gras 2012-01-31 16:17:06 +01:00
  • b33f504e8f APFS: fix link issue when compiling with Clang Thomas Veerman 2012-02-02 15:00:01 +00:00
  • a65ff8a1aa INET: fix 'improved' assert Thomas Veerman 2012-02-02 11:53:52 +00:00
  • 23491b7f46 Remove unused variables Thomas Veerman 2012-02-02 10:47:06 +00:00
  • 224a0f6e90 INET: fix a few GCC compilation warnings Thomas Veerman 2012-01-31 15:43:00 +00:00
  • 71634240a0 libpuffs: make GCC happy Thomas Veerman 2012-02-01 11:44:26 +00:00
  • 4d3a0887b4 AVFS: only put mount point when it was used as one Thomas Veerman 2012-02-01 11:34:40 +00:00
  • d4cdd59eaa service: allow starting service with user's realuid Thomas Veerman 2012-02-01 13:21:56 +00:00
  • d5210e9bdd e1000: reset hardware before stopping Thomas Veerman 2012-01-30 14:32:31 +00:00
  • a87ec6840f INET: remove erroneous assert Thomas Veerman 2012-01-30 15:14:19 +00:00
  • 1ff24e3f2f Don't panic on a misconfigured machine Thomas Veerman 2012-01-30 15:12:12 +00:00
  • 1fc399a5c1 Add permission test for bind and socket Thomas Veerman 2012-01-27 16:06:43 +00:00
  • 9330d92639 INET: drop privileges upon startup Thomas Veerman 2012-01-27 14:21:10 +00:00
  • becf700bc2 APFS: drop privileges upon startup Thomas Veerman 2012-01-27 14:18:41 +00:00
  • 9233fdb359 AVFS: make forbidden check for specific proc instead of fp Thomas Veerman 2012-01-27 13:54:35 +00:00
  • 0e537f1085 AVFS: initialize root FS before receiving new work Thomas Veerman 2012-01-27 13:38:40 +00:00
  • 0bd011affd PM: extend srv_fork to set a specific UID Thomas Veerman 2012-01-27 11:50:11 +00:00
  • 4bee3cff2e Prevent the ramdisk makefile from failing if the last image is not ELF Erik van der Kouwe 2012-01-27 13:09:26 +01:00
  • 5c0927e108 SMP - clock calibration spurious IRQ deadlock fix Tomas Hruby 2012-01-26 11:39:40 +00:00
  • c468f4efa5 SMP - no_apic=0 and acpi=1 set when CONFIG_SMP=y Tomas Hruby 2012-01-25 19:02:13 +00:00
  • 9e1d244cbe Revert 93b9873a56 Tomas Hruby 2012-01-25 18:59:18 +00:00
  • 57b2fe851c mtree: zoneinfo dirs Ben Gras 2012-01-20 19:13:20 +01:00
  • 57794c6690 Don't overwrite old mv, ln, cp, etc man pages with new rm Antoine Leca 2012-01-19 10:12:55 +00:00
  • e894c9e1b5 Don't print events that happen often Thomas Veerman 2012-01-19 17:06:14 +00:00
  • 700641afb8 lseek should not yield a negative file position Thomas Veerman 2012-01-16 15:09:55 +00:00
  • 5691dca9f4 Don't try to find file position beyond double indirect blocks Thomas Veerman 2012-01-16 14:46:47 +00:00
  • ddbdca6cdb Add support for survival of crashed FSs Thomas Veerman 2012-01-19 14:21:46 +00:00
  • dd59d50944 mfs: mark blocks clean when invalidated Ben Gras 2012-01-13 16:05:32 +01:00
  • a6d0ee24c3 Use correct value for _NSIG Thomas Veerman 2012-01-16 11:42:29 +00:00
  • a282e942bf INET: initialize timer to not-in-use Thomas Veerman 2012-01-13 16:48:46 +00:00
  • e35528ae79 New zoneinfo port from NetBSD Thomas Veerman 2012-01-16 11:03:25 +00:00
  • e257c999b8 Replace rm and rmdir with NetBSD version Thomas Veerman 2012-01-16 10:46:14 +00:00
  • f18dab92bf Remove unused variable Thomas Veerman 2012-01-12 16:58:55 +00:00
  • 078adc7ed7 Increase thread stack space for GCC compiled images Thomas Veerman 2012-01-12 16:35:36 +00:00
  • e6c98c3c55 AVFS: Return actual last dir when path is named by a symlink Thomas Veerman 2012-01-12 11:32:31 +00:00
  • c89aaf7a87 vfs/avfs: renumber stat calls so as to be unique David van Moolenbroek 2012-01-13 00:49:37 +01:00
  • 2c685f34e0 Cut PM out of the adddma/deldma/getdma call path David van Moolenbroek 2012-01-13 00:23:04 +01:00
  • 8cb7ba7951 Remove obsolete PROCSTAT/getsigset call. David van Moolenbroek 2012-01-12 23:33:46 +01:00
  • 2fe79d0b76 Implement AcpiOsStall, AcpiOsSleep, AcpiOsGetTimer Jan Wieck 2012-01-13 18:35:13 +00:00
  • 4668b84158 vm_remap_ro Ben Gras 2011-11-28 19:05:50 +01:00
  • 88f990e122 VM - vm_unmap() takes SELF as valid argument Tomas Hruby 2011-10-18 18:21:07 +00:00
  • 974452d4dd VM - clear vminhibit iff it was set Tomas Hruby 2011-11-06 21:37:34 +00:00
  • 758d788bbe SMP - asyn send SMP safe Tomas Hruby 2011-10-25 18:32:30 +00:00
  • 0bb56e0e04 SMP - smp_schedule() Tomas Hruby 2011-11-04 17:59:31 +00:00
  • 41bd5f2fc6 SMP - cpu_is_idle made volatile Tomas Hruby 2011-11-04 17:47:45 +00:00
  • 8fa95abae4 SMP - fixed usage of stale TLB entries Tomas Hruby 2011-11-04 17:33:07 +00:00
  • 0a55e63413 SMP - fixed IPI livelock Tomas Hruby 2011-10-26 15:43:36 +00:00
  • 0468fca72b SMP - do_update fix Tomas Hruby 2011-10-16 22:05:40 +00:00
  • 192db70960 KERNEL - cause SIGSEGV if bad pointer to kernel Tomas Hruby 2011-12-05 01:08:48 +00:00
  • c82a5dd3e3 KERNEL - mini_senda simplification Tomas Hruby 2011-11-04 18:25:27 +00:00
  • e4d46a2146 KERNEL - has_pending() not exposed Tomas Hruby 2011-10-31 15:21:08 +00:00
  • 8d0a1f71bf KERNEL - do_privctl() fix Tomas Hruby 2011-10-18 18:19:24 +00:00
  • fecaba7ff1 Increase ramdisk size for clang Arun Thomas 2012-01-12 17:01:48 +01:00
  • 36d29dedd5 Allow clang for kernel compilation Antoine Leca 2011-12-26 17:33:18 +01:00
  • a4d01f8a83 Fix tll state bug Thomas Veerman 2012-01-11 10:20:44 +00:00
  • af6c39fb9b /etc/shells Ben Gras 2012-01-11 15:20:48 +01:00
  • 7cd4002083 vm: clear map cache after kernel requests Ben Gras 2012-01-02 18:20:02 +01:00
  • 0bb4bb9d51 move pax and chmod for useradd Ben Gras 2012-01-11 00:26:09 +01:00
  • 11c15db517 rc: transitional fix for old fstab David van Moolenbroek 2012-01-10 15:05:28 +01:00
  • d6c5a1280e Convert s_block_size on MFSv3. Evgeniy Ivanov 2012-01-08 23:52:57 +04:00